How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 31326?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 31326 Studio Apartments | $1,472 | $1,000 | $1,682 |
| 31326 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,520 | $850 | $1,945 |
| 31326 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,758 | $560 | $2,225 |
| 31326 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,167 | $1,295 | $3,554 |
| 31326 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,486 | $2,233 | $2,619 |
